Adobe Photoshop Express Beta Updates

Wednesday July 30, 2008
Photoshop Express has recently been updated with some great-sounding new features. First, the one I've been waiting for--drag and drop uploading from the desktop. This should make it much easier to get your pictures onto the Photoshop Express web site from any application. They have also added photo printing services through Shutterfly, music tracks for slide shows, keyword tags for organization, and a much-requested resizing tool. Now users can also download photos from other users' public galleries as well.
